Output 8866ce60d173bf9f8c8b7f8341dbcc5840a7423f00c17e847ceb57db833a44c1:1

value
283353360
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5ca4cd58a744dcf20dabed411103d93e967a5fdb OP_EQUALVERIFY OP_CHECKSIG
address
19SrbJUx5bca7GnBMVF6g4ZkNe4p4WnyWb
transaction
8866ce60d173bf9f8c8b7f8341dbcc5840a7423f00c17e847ceb57db833a44c1
confirmations
570196
spent
true